基于51单片机的智能跟随旅行箱

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

基于51单片机的智能跟随旅行箱

发表时间:2019-07-08T12:30:39.180Z 来源:《电力设备》2019年第4期作者:陈远奇1 牛超2 郭茹博 3 胥克4

[导读] 摘要:针对现有旅行箱携带不方便等众多问题,设计了一款可以对指定目标进行实时跟随的旅行箱。

(甘肃省西北民族大学电气工程学院甘肃兰州 730124)

摘要:针对现有旅行箱携带不方便等众多问题,设计了一款可以对指定目标进行实时跟随的旅行箱。智能跟随旅行箱采用STC89C52单片机为控制核心,具有超声波跟随系统,利用车前三个反射式接受探头来监测周围的信息,并肩检测的信号返回给单片机,以此来实现自动跟随功能。基于51单片机的智能跟随旅行箱的系统结构简单,性能稳定,实时性好性价比高,具有广泛的应用价值和广阔的应用前景。

关键词:自动跟随;无轨跟随;智能跟随旅行箱

随着科技的进步以及人们生活水平的提高,外出旅行已经成为人们生活中不可或缺的一部分了,但是对于经常外出的商务人士和行动有所不变的人来说,旅行箱是一个累赘,而智能跟随旅行箱可以显著的减少人们的工作量,此研究具有比较广泛的应用范围,例如商场,工厂,宾馆,超市,酒店等公共场合。极大程度上解放了人们的双手,方便了人们的生活。

1系统总体设计

1.1硬件总体设计

该智能旅行箱以STC89C52为核心控制系统来控制其他多个模块相互配合工作,模块部分由电机模块,电源模块,驱动模块,红外模块等其他模块构成。控制芯片通过对超声波测距模块反馈的信息进行处理后,将信号发送到L298N电机驱动模块,完成对电机的控制。电源模块给电机驱动模块,控制系统,以及超声波模块供电。

图1 总体设计图

1.2超声波模块

超声波是指频率高于20kHz的声波,超声波在介质中传播时遇到不同的界而将产生反射、绕射、折射等原理在各行各业得到广泛应用[1]。超声波传感器具有不易受环境因素十扰,能量消耗缓慢,在介质中传播的距离较远等优点,因而超声波经常用于距离的测量[2]。超声波定位系统可以在一定范围内无接触定位,定位精度可达1cm。同时使用3个超声波模块,利用他们收到的超声波信号的时差,来计算发射端与接受端的相对位置,从而实现对指定目标的定位。

1.3电机驱动模块

本设计采用可以同时驱动两组电机的L298N驱动模块来驱动四个电机,这样可以保持整个系统的稳定性,也可以获得较大的速度和功率,通过超声波模块反馈给单片机的信号,单片机通过控制输入到L298N的驱动模块使能端的脉冲占空比从而控制电机的速度以此来实现转弯和直行。

1.4电源模块

保证智能旅行箱的性能,供电系统采用直流+10V电压对电机驱动进行供电,保证智能旅行箱的性能。用L7805CV稳压芯片将电压稳压至5V,以保证控制系统的正常工作。电源部分电路设计简单方便,同时也充分发挥了稳压器保护电路的作用[3]。

2 系统软件设计

在系统启动后,最先开始的工作是时钟配置,相关程序所需的串口初始化,延时函数初始化。然后定时器初始化,对三个超声波测距模块[4]测得的数据进行比例控制计算,并根据输出量控制电机的转速。

3 实验测试

通过对智能旅行箱的模拟环境测试,该设计可以实现对特定目标的跟随,各个系统的运行状态较好,反映比较迅速,响应时间较短。本系统的整体性能优良,能满足了智能旅行箱的设计需求。

4结语

以STC89C52为主要核心,设计并制造了智能跟随旅行箱,该设计结构简单,采用模块化设计,具有良好的扩展性和独立性,较高的

稳定性和灵敏性,实时性好,低成本等特点,在多个场所都有着极高的实用价值。但是在行李箱选择行走移动的路径和速度控制等方面还需要进一步研究。

参考文献:

[1]陈洁,余诗诗,李斌等.基于双阀值比较法超声波流量计处理信号口[J].仪器仪表学报2014,35(10):2223-2230.

[2]张艳,贾应炜.基于HC-RS04模块的超声波测距系统设计[J].自动化技术与应用,2016,35(03):101-104+109.

[3]聂宪波,邵泽箭,巩文文,关立强,赵昊宁.基于单片机自动跟随小车的设计与制作[J].山东工业技术,2015(04):158.

[4]许文卓,顾亭,孙浩谛,刘勇.基于红外循迹的火灾报警小车循迹算法研究[J].甘肃科技,2017,33(04):11-13.

相关文档
最新文档